Ravens are extremely intelligent birds.

Studies have demonstrated that at four months old the sleek black birds haveintelligence equivalent to that of adult apes.

Mischief, a charming crow trained byPaige Davis, had a particular talent for human speech.

Though Mischief the white-necked raven passed in April 2020, he had 20 years of a marvelous avian life.

The bird lived at theWorld Bird Sanctuaryin Valley Park, Missouri.

The sanctuary is devoted to conservation, rehabilitation, and education.

A licensed falconer, Davis trained the bird toretrieve and stackthe colorful rings made for human children.

Ravens can make over 100 specific vocalizations.

They are among the many species of birds which can mimic human words.

TheAfrican grey parrotis the most verbose, but starlings, magpies, and parakeets can all copy humans.

Mischieflike many of his fellow chatty birdsdisplayed other fascinating behaviors.
